New York, NY—NERA Economic Consulting, a leading global provider of economic advice and analysis in business, legal, and regulatory matters, is pleased to announce that Managing Directors Oscar Arnedillo and Sean Gammons have been recognized as energy experts in Who’s Who Legal: Energy 2018.
For the first time, Who’s Who Legal has extended its research and nomination process to identify “the leading consultants, economists, and expert witnesses working in the energy sector.” Mr. Arnedillo and Mr. Gammons are two of only 47 global experts identified by the publisher.
Mr. Arnedillo specializes in the energy sector, with particular emphasis in regulatory and corporate issues that arise in the transition from a regulated to a competitive electricity system. Mr. Arnedillo has advised on corporate, competition policy, and regulatory strategy issues such as market reform, wholesale market rules, spot market modeling, spot market bidding strategy, codes of conduct, load profiles, retail strategy, tariff design (for full-service, access to the network, and supplier of last resort), stranded costs valuation and recovery, distribution and transmission tariff reviews, cost of capital estimation for regulated and competitive activities, company structure, and transfer pricing.
Mr. Gammons is the head of NERA’s London office and specializes in regulatory, competition, and valuation issues in the gas and electricity industries. His experience includes regulatory work on market rules, tariff design, and antitrust enforcement (e.g., merger approval and state aid), as well as commercial work on contract design, pricing, investment appraisal, and risk management. Mr. Gammons has led numerous due diligence and valuation exercises in support of M&A transactions, greenfield investment, and financings in the deregulated, regulated, and hybrid (low-carbon) segments of the energy industry. Mr Gammons is also an experienced expert witness and has provided expert testimony in cases covering contractual disputes (e.g., construction, sale and purchase, M&A, and broker disputes), antitrust matters, and energy industry regulation in a wide range of jurisdictions around the world, including the International Centre for Settlement of Investment Disputes (ICSID), the International Chamber of Commerce (ICC), and the English High Court.
